What are UPVC Windows and Doors?
UPVC doors and windows are made from a robust and durable product called unplasticized polyvinyl chloride. Unlike traditional materials like wood or aluminum, UPVC is understood for its resistance to weathering, rust, and chemical damage. These features make UPVC a perfect option for contemporary homes, combining both performance and visual appeal.

Advantages of UPVC Windows and Doors
UPVC doors and windows offer a multitude of benefits, making them a preferred choice amongst homeowners and builders. Some of these advantages consist of:
Energy Efficiency:
- UPVC doors and windows have excellent thermal insulation residential or commercial properties, avoiding heat loss throughout winter and heat entry in summer. This can substantially decrease energy expenses.
Boosted Security:
- Many UPVC profiles come with multi-point locking systems and reinforced structures that supply increased security versus burglaries.
Low Maintenance:
- Unlike wood, which needs routine painting and treatment, UPVC does not require regular maintenance. Cleaning up is as simple as cleaning with a moist fabric.
Visual Appeal:
- UPVC doors and windows can be personalized to match any architectural style and come in different colors and finishes, including wood-grain results, supplying the desired visual without the typical disadvantages of wood.
Sound Reduction:
- The airtight seal of UPVC frames assists to block out external noise, adding an aspect of serenity to the living environment.
Cost-Effective:
- Although the preliminary investment may be slightly greater than standard doors and windows, the long-term cost savings on maintenance and energy bills make UPVC an affordable choice.
Installation of UPVC Windows and Doors
The setup process of UPVC windows and doors is crucial for ensuring their efficiency and durability. Here's an introduction of the actions involved:
Step-by-Step Installation Process
Measurement:
- Accurate measurements of window and door openings are essential to guaranteeing an ideal fit.
Preparation:
- Remove any existing frames and prepare the openings by cleaning and leveling the surfaces.
Dry Fit:
- Place the UPVC frames into the openings without attaching them to inspect for fit and make sure that they are level.
Securing the Frame:
- Once properly fitted, the frames are secured utilizing screws or other fasteners, guaranteeing they are sealed tightly.
Sealing:
- Apply proper sealants to avoid air and water infiltration, further improving the energy efficiency of the setup.
Finishing Touches:
- Install trims or finishing pieces to offer the installation a sleek appearance.
Upkeep of UPVC Windows and Doors
Though UPVC requires very little upkeep, suitable care can ensure longevity and optimum performance. Here are some upkeep tips:
Maintenance Tips for UPVC Windows and Doors
- Regular Cleaning: Use moderate detergents with water to clean the frames and glass.
- Examine Seals and Hinges: Regularly check weather condition seals and hinges and replace them if worn or harmed.
- Lubrication: Apply a silicon-based lubricant to moving parts like locks and hinges to ensure smooth operation.
- Examine for Damage: Periodically look for any indications of damage or wear and address concerns without delay.
Frequently Asked Questions About UPVC Windows and Doors
Q1: How long do UPVC doors and windows last?
A1: UPVC windows and doors can last approximately 25 years or longer, depending upon the quality of the products and maintenance.
Q2: Are UPVC windows energy effective?
A2: Yes, UPVC windows and doors provide outstanding insulation, assisting to lower energy bills and preserve indoor convenience.
Q3: Can UPVC windows and doors be painted?
A3: While painting UPVC is possible, it is usually not advised as it can void service warranties. UPVC is offered in various surfaces that do not need painting.
Q4: Are UPVC windows protect?
A4: Yes, UPVC doors and windows included multi-point locking systems and can be strengthened for added security.
Q5: How do UPVC windows compare with wooden windows?
A5: UPVC windows are typically more resilient, need less upkeep, and supply much better insulation compared to wooden windows, which are more vulnerable to rot and need regular upkeep.
